I have large clear container to place my chameleon inside. I put some branches and place the container in a dark room while I rearrange the cage/do maintenance cleaning. Have some leather gloves. They act like drama queens. But for a good reason.
 
Some dragon ledges would help you secure more branches and climbing opportunities with more ease
These really are great for creating the levels and highways in your enclosure. I always try to make vertical levels at three areas in the environment. Upper, middle, and lower like a three story building with a few options to navigate from one level to the next

Dragon ledges, or something like them, makes this process so much easier. Grab a bag of zip ties and some hedge trimmers and you can make whatever sort of Cham gymnasium you like

And yes adding a taller growing plant at the bottom will create more shelter and more highways to climb in and around and over
